摘要: 为了给通化吉恩镍业有限公司松柏岭铜镍矿石的分选工艺改造提供依据,对该矿石进行了工艺矿物学研究。研究结果表明:铜、镍在矿石中主要以黄铜矿和红砷镍矿的形式存在;铜、镍矿物嵌布特征复杂、嵌布粒度细微,大量含镁脉石矿物的存在等是铜、镍分选的不利影响因素。

Abstract: In order to provide basis for separation process of Songbailing copper and nickel ores in Tonghua Ji'en Nickel Industry Co., Ltd., the process mineralogy on the ores are studied.Research results show that copper and nickel ores mainly exist in chalcopyrite and niccolite.Some factors like complicated disseminated characteristics of copper and nickel minerals, fine disseminated grain size, and existence of numerous magnesium-bearing gangue minerals bring adverse impact on the separation of copper and nickel.
